Author: petarj
Date: Wed Dec 7 16:19:26 2016
New Revision: 3286
Log:
mips: small changes in VexGuestMIPS{32|64}State structs
Move host_EvC_FAILADDR and host_EvC_COUNTER fields to the top of the
structure, similar to other architectures.
This fixes
none/tests/libvexmultiarch_test (stderr)
on some MIPS platforms, as it avoids internal X86/AMD code generator
asserts.
Minor stylish changes included too.
Patch by Aleksandra Karadzic.
Modified:
trunk/priv/host_mips_defs.c
trunk/priv/host_mips_defs.h
trunk/priv/host_mips_isel.c
trunk/pub/libvex_guest_mips32.h
trunk/pub/libvex_guest_mips64.h
